PM Modi chairs meeting on Ukraine crisis, evaluates evacuation progress

New Delhi, March 4: Prime Minister Narendra Modi convened a high-level conference on the Russia-Ukraine issue on Friday, during which he evaluated Operation Ganga’s progress.

The discussion takes place in the aftermath of an Indian student being shot and hospitalised in Kyiv. General VK Singh, a Union minister, said on Friday that he had received reports that a student had been fired at and had been taken to the hospital.

Notably, PM Modi has been conducting a series of high-level discussions since Russia and Ukraine went all-out war. Prime Minister Modi has met with Russian President Vladimir Putin and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elensky.

Meanwhile, operation Ganga was begun under Prime Minister Modi’s guidance, with four Union ministers dispatched to four Ukraine’s neighbouring countries to oversee every part of the evacuation.

Three more Indian Air Force C-17 aircraft arrived at Hindan airport late last night and early Friday morning, bringing 630 Indian nationals from Ukraine via Romanian and Hungarian airfields as part of Operation Ganga.

Over 9,000 Indians have been transported back to India from Ukraine, according to the external affairs ministry.
